Mind Over Batter: 75 Recipes for Baking as Therapy


Overview

You may not realise it, but many essential therapeutic techniques can be accessed right in your own kitchen. In Mind Over Batter, licensed therapist and master baker Jack Hazan guides you through 75 simple, healing recipes that can help you tap into whatever you might be going through that day. Inspired by the Syrian and Middle Eastern baked goods he grew up with, along with his take on classic American desserts, recipes are organised into themed chapters based on common life moments and needs. In need of connection? Make some Pesto Pull-Apart Bread to share with your loved ones. Looking for a way to release some anxiety? Knead away your stress with a Chocolate Babka Crunch. Simply in need of some self-care? Whip up a single-serving indulgence like a Devil’s Food Mug Cake. Throughout each chapter are invaluable exercises and 'quick sessions' that connect baking processes to the evidence-based therapy tools Jack uses in his practice every day.

Author Information

Jack Hazan, LMHC, CSAT is a New York City–based therapist, and the founder of Bryant Park Therapy and the company JackBakes, whose baked goods are carried in over 100 physical and online retailers. Jack has been featured in Time Out New York and the New York Post and has appeared on Bravo’s Watch What Happens Live and the Food Network.
